Dr. W. J. Battle

Description: Photograph of Dr. Battle seated in a chair reading a book. Dr. Battle was a professor of classical languages at The University of Texas. He retired in 1948. He designed the UT seal and was instrumental in the founding The University Co-op.

Jefferson Chemical Company

Description: Exterior view of buildings and sign which reads "Jefferson Chemical Company, Inc. - Austin Laboratories" Jefferson Chemical Company was located at 7114 Georgetown Rd. (North Lamar).
